Intergovernmental Organization (IGO) The term intergovernmental organization (IGO) refers to an entity created by treaty, involving two or more nations, to work in good faith, on issues of common interest.The Delian League (478–404 BC, and subsequently from 378–338 BC), an alliance of Greek city-states, may be considered the first example of an IGO.the Congress of Vienna of 1815 may be regarded as the actual birth of international organizations.

Non-governmental organization (NGO) A non-governmental organization (NGO) is any non-profit, voluntary citizens' group which is organized on a local, national or international level.The Red Cross: The World’s HelperFounded by 16 nations in 1863, the International Red Cross is the first NGO

NGOS

Provide services that fill gaps left by the private and public sectors. Usually to further the political or social goals of their members.Include improving the state of the natural environment Encouraging the observance of human rightsImproving the welfare of the disadvantaged.

PROBLEMS AND ISSUES

Page 25: IGOs, NGOs
Page 26: IGOs, NGOs

Corruption : the employees who work in NGOs make false bills

Provide poor quality to beneficiaries

Government also create hurdles for NGOs, specially working for women rights has

become a challenge.

Some people manipulate in the name of NGOs just to make their black money into white

money and also for not paying tax.
